Sb₈O₁₆ is an antimony oxide ceramic compound belonging to the family of metal oxides with potential semiconductor properties. This material is primarily of research interest rather than established industrial use, investigated for its electrical and optical characteristics within the broader context of oxide semiconductors and functional ceramics. Its applications would likely target niche electronics, sensor, or photonic device development where antimony oxides' unique band structure and chemical stability offer advantages over conventional semiconductors.
